What Are Carbon Credits?

Carbon credits are permits that allow the holder to emit a certain amount of carbon dioxide or other greenhouse gases. One credit typically equals one ton of CO2 emissions. Companies that reduce their emissions below their allocated limit can sell their excess credits to others who need them. This system incentivizes businesses to adopt greener practices.

What Are Futures Contracts?

Futures contracts are agreements to buy or sell an asset (like carbon credits) at a predetermined price and date in the future. They are commonly used for hedging or speculation. In the context of carbon credits, futures contracts allow traders to bet on the future price of these credits.

Risks of Trading Carbon Credit Futures

  • **Market Volatility**: Prices can fluctuate rapidly due to policy changes or market sentiment.
  • **Regulatory Changes**: New laws or regulations can impact the carbon credit market.
  • **Liquidity Risks**: Some carbon credit futures markets may have lower liquidity, making it harder to enter or exit positions.
